package org.apache.accumulo.examples.helloworld;
import org.apache.accumulo.core.client.mapreduce.AccumuloOutputFormat;
import org.apache.accumulo.core.data.Mutation;
import org.apache.accumulo.core.data.Value;
import org.apache.accumulo.core.util.CachedConfiguration;
import org.apache.hadoop.conf.Configuration;
import org.apache.hadoop.conf.Configured;
import org.apache.hadoop.io.Text;
import org.apache.hadoop.mapreduce.Job;
import org.apache.hadoop.mapreduce.RecordWriter;
import org.apache.hadoop.mapreduce.TaskAttemptContext;
import org.apache.hadoop.mapreduce.TaskAttemptID;
import org.apache.hadoop.util.Tool;
import org.apache.hadoop.util.ToolRunner;
public class InsertWithOutputFormat extends Configured implements Tool {
// this is a tool because when you run a mapreduce, you will need to use the
// ToolRunner
// if you want libjars to be passed properly to the map and reduce tasks
// even though this class isn't a mapreduce
@Override
public int run(String[] args) throws Exception {
if (args.length != 5) {
System.out.println("Usage: accumulo " + this.getClass().getName() + " <instance name> <zoo keepers> <tablename> <username> <password>");
return 1;
}
Text tableName = new Text(args[2]);
Job job = new Job(getConf());
Configuration conf = job.getConfiguration();
AccumuloOutputFormat.setZooKeeperInstance(job, args[0], args[1]);
AccumuloOutputFormat.setOutputInfo(job, args[3], args[4].getBytes(), true, null);
job.setOutputFormatClass(AccumuloOutputFormat.class);
// when running a mapreduce, you won't need to instantiate the output
// format and record writer
// mapreduce will do that for you, and you will just use
// output.collect(tableName, mutation)
TaskAttemptContext context = new TaskAttemptContext(conf, new TaskAttemptID());
RecordWriter<Text,Mutation> rw = new AccumuloOutputFormat().getRecordWriter(context);
Text colf = new Text("colfam");
System.out.println("writing ...");
for (int i = 0; i < 10000; i++) {
Mutation m = new Mutation(new Text(String.format("row_%d", i)));
for (int j = 0; j < 5; j++) {
m.put(colf, new Text(String.format("colqual_%d", j)), new Value((String.format("value_%d_%d", i, j)).getBytes()));
}
rw.write(tableName, m); // repeat until done
if (i % 100 == 0)
System.out.println(i);
}
rw.close(context); // close when done
return 0;
}
public static void main(String[] args) throws Exception {
System.exit(ToolRunner.run(CachedConfiguration.getInstance(), new InsertWithOutputFormat(), args));
}
}
